
A total of eight possible traits, any combination of which can be applied to your own dog, make up Hyemin Kim’s MBTI for dogs, and a piece of dog furniture is associated with each personality type. Hyemin Kim, the designer behind MUF, created her own doggo-inspired MBTI system that comprises different personality traits for different dogs. For example, I am an INFP, indicating introversion, intuition, feeling, and perceiving, which ultimately reveals how I interact with everyday life and decision-making. Inspired by the MBTI, which is a lengthy introspective test that indicates different tendencies in regard to test-takers personalities. MUF is more of a curatorial experience for you and your pup.

In fact, you can even schedule and set up four massages for your dog in a day! You can pair it up to your smartphone via WiFi or Bluetooth connectivity, and control the bed through your phone. The massaging bed provides a 3D cloud wave vibration massage using its layers of orthopedic and memory foam. If your doggo has been around for a while and is aging, then the Dog Cloud Bed may just be the perfect bed for him! The Cloud Bed is a therapeutic bed that helps relieve any joint pain or discomfort they may be experiencing, by massaging them. To help Scraps move up and down the chair’s steps with more confidence, Giertz narrowed the distance between the steps and added a railing system to border the chair’s stairs, main seat, and roof. On top of the chair’s joined bottom piece, the rest of the CNC-milled pieces of plywood came together.

Giertz turned to CNC milling to construct the chair’s bottom piece, this time formed in two sections to fit onto the CNC bed. After mounting the pieces of plywood together to form the prototype’s planned structure, Giertz uses screws to attach them, but the finished prototype saw some improvements. Employing CNC milling to construct the chair’s top seat and roof, sidewalls, stairs, and front entryway, Giertz cut vertical ridges along the sidewalls to bend them around the radius of the chair. Using Fusion 360, Giertz created a 3D model of the pet chair. The model features an enclosed crate, the main dog door, footrest, stairs, and roof to also work as Giertz’s seat. In her uploaded YouTube video, A chair made for needy pets Giertz takes us through the construction of both the chair’s initial prototype and its final form.
